I'm most likely trading my wheels and tires and $600 for a set of Tommy Kaira 18's with some good bridgestones on there and a big brake kit (with the adapter to use your stock calipers) for all 4 corners. I dunno if you guys know what the Tommy Kaira wheels are but it was a "special edition" WRX only sold in Japan and I believe there are only about 500 made... so these wheels never made it to the states unless imported. VERY rare. I didnt really like the thought of gold or 18's on my car, but they only weigh 17 lbs. each which is super light. Here is a pic of the wheels.
